FARMING FRIDAYS | 1150 Quail Gardens Dr
Jul 18, 2025 (UTC-7)
Encinitas
Join us on the farm for Farming Fridays from 9:00-11:00am! These community farming workshops are an opportunity to get your hands in the soil, connect with our farm and farmers, and learn some basic regenerative farming skills. Workshop activities vary depending on the week and may include: seeding, transplanting, weeding, preparing beds for planting, harvesting, watering, animal care, and more. We’ll make sure you leave with some farm fresh veggies.
Kids under 13 must be accompanied by a parent or guardian. Anyone 13-18 years must have a parent or guardian sign a liability waiver upon drop-off.
Please wear close-toed shoes (required). We recommend comfortable farming attire with good coverage from the sun. Please bring: water, sunscreen, hat and optional snack.
Meeting Point:
Meet at the north patio outside of the Harvest Market.

Sunset Yoga | Alila Marea Beach Resort Encinitas
Jul 1, 2025 (UTC-7)ENDED
Encinitas
Join us on the Bluff at Alila Marea Beach Resort for Sunset Yoga. Movements are steady and deliberate, and will bring about strength, flexibility, focus and expansion of the heart. Every class is different but follows the same template: meditation, breathwork, sun salutations, standing poses, balancing poses, options for inversions, deep holds, back bends and eventually – the long awaited Savasana. We end class with a 10 minute rest, accompanied by sound bowls.

The Weekend Wonder Lab | 282 N El Camino Real ste c
Jul 13, 2025 (UTC-7)ENDED
Encinitas
The Weekend Wonder Lab is a makerspace where emerging creators can develop creative confidence while enjoying the freedom of their own pace. Little Sparks (ages 5-7) design and dream while the Next Gen (ages 8-12) create and innovate.
The Weekend Wonder Lab is a creative, hands-on learning environment where participants can explore, build, and invent using a variety of tools and materials. It encourages curiosity, problem-solving, and collaboration through activities like crafting, musical composition, building, and using accessable technology. The space is designed to be safe, engaging, and age-appropriate, helping kids learn through play and experimentation.
